What are the most effective ways to prevent damage from tree sap or resin?
Tree sap and resin can be a nuisance, leaving sticky stains on cars, outdoor furniture, and even skin. Fortunately, there are several effective ways to prevent and remove this stubborn substance.
1. Use Protective Covers – If you park under trees, invest in a high-quality car cover to shield your vehicle from dripping sap. For outdoor furniture, waterproof covers can prevent resin buildup.
2. Regular Washing – Wash your car or surfaces frequently with soapy water to remove sap before it hardens. A gentle detergent or specialized automotive cleaner works best.
3. Rubbing Alcohol or Hand Sanitizer – For dried sap, apply rubbing alcohol or hand sanitizer to a cloth and gently rub the affected area. This helps dissolve the resin without damaging paint or skin.
4. Olive Oil or WD-40 – These household items can break down sticky sap. Apply a small amount, let it sit for a few minutes, then wipe clean with a microfiber cloth.
5. Clay Bar Treatment – For cars with stubborn sap residue, a detailing clay bar can safely lift the residue without scratching the paint.
6. Avoid Direct Sun Exposure – Sap hardens faster in heat. If possible, park in shaded or covered areas to minimize sap adhesion.
7. Skin Protection – If sap gets on your skin, use baby oil or coconut oil to dissolve it, then wash with warm soapy water.
By following these methods, you can effectively prevent and remove tree sap or resin damage, keeping your belongings clean and well-maintained.
